    her. It did not strike her but struck a pot near her and broke it. She went to bed very quickly as she was very frightened. Next morning on looking at the hob she found that there was nothing wrong but the broken pot reminded her of her experience of the night before. No stone appeared to be disturbed on the hob.
    Soon after she got a very sore heel for no apparent reason. She was laid up for a year. After that she made sure to go to bed early every night. She blamed the sore heel to the stone which was thrown and the throwing of the stone to her staying up late and being in the way of some other who probably wanted the fire.
